Earthy Notes

Earthy notes form one of the most grounding and evocative elements in perfumery, capturing the scent of soil after rain, damp woods, and natural minerals. They evoke the raw essence of nature — deep, organic, and quietly powerful — bringing authenticity and balance to both classic and modern compositions.

Their aroma is rich and textured, combining elements of wet soil, moss, roots, and wood. Used mainly as base notes, Earthy accords add depth and realism, anchoring lighter ingredients with warmth and stability. They create the impression of being outdoors, surrounded by forests, fields, and the living energy of the earth itself.

Perfumers often build Earthy notes using patchouli, vetiver, oakmoss, and mushroom accords. These combine beautifully with florals to add contrast, or with woods, amber, and leather for depth and sensuality.
